  • Patent number: 6081115
    Abstract: In a method of measuring an exchange force between a specimen and a probe, the specimen and probe are faced to each other with a distance within a close proximity or RKKY-type exchange interaction region from a distance at which conduction electron clouds begin to be overlapped with each other to a distance at which localized electron clouds are not substantially overlapped with each other, a relative displacement of the specimen and probe is detected to measure a first force under such a condition that directions of magnetic moments of said specimen surface and probe are in parallel with each other to derive a first force and under such a condition that directions of magnetic moments of said specimen surface and probe are in anti-parallel with each other to derive a second force. An exchange force is derived as a difference between said first and second forces. Magnetic property of the specimen can be evaluated on the basis of the thus measured exchange force.

  • Patent number: 6078174
    Abstract: In an apparatus for measuring an exchange force between a specimen and a probe, the specimen and probe are faced to each other with a distance within a close proximity or RKKY-type exchange interaction region from a distance at which conduction electron clouds begin to be overlapped with each other to a distance at which localized electron clouds are not substantially overlapped with each other. In order to prevent the probe from being attracted to the specimen by a force between the specimen and the force, a piezoelectric element is provided on a cantilever and a control signal supplied to the piezoelectric element is produced in accordance with a displacement of the cantilever to control a spring constant of the cantilever. The exchange force between the specimen and the probe is calculated from the control signal supplied to the piezoelectric element.

  • Patent number: 4341729
    Abstract: An apparatus for making biaxially stretched tubular films of thermoplastic synthetic resin which permits operation in a stabilized manner and economically by using the hot air used in stretching a bubble again in heating a raw film. In said apparatus, a suction ring is provided in the section where a heated raw film is inflated by the gas filled therein under pressure, and the diameter of the resulting stretched bubble reaches its maximum diameter. The suction ring sucks the air used for heating the stretching part simultaneously with the air used for cooling it after stretching to attain a thermal interception effect between the stretching part and the cooling part after stretching. Air flow around the stretching bubble is made uniform.

  • Patent number: 4299793
    Abstract: An apparatus for producing tubular plastic films having extremely small variation of flat width in stabilized manner is provided. Said apparatus comprises a blower, a valve for controlling the amount of air, an air reservoir, a connecting pipe for connecting these blower, valve and air reservoir and another connecting pipe which connects said reservoir to the inside of a bubble formed on the tip end of a mold fixed to the outlet of an extruder through said mold to feed or discharge the air into the inside of said bubble continuously in a non-step manner, thereby to keep the inside pressure of said bubble uniform.

  • Patent number: 4290996
    Abstract: A method for rendering initiation of stretching easier in the production of biaxial stretched film of plastic tube carried out by enclosing gas in said tube and by the difference in the peripheral velocity between delivery nip rolls and take-up nip rolls is provided. This method is characterized by passing said tube between at last one pair of nipping means for enclosing gas, having therebetween a clearance adjustable in the range of 1.about.10 mm. The nipping means are provided before or behind said take-up nip rolls and driven at a peripheral speed same as that of said take-up nip rolls.

  • Patent number: 4279580
    Abstract: An apparatus for producing biaxially stretched tubular films which enables heating air for stretching to pass uniformly around the circumference of a stretching bubble thereby to effect stabilized operation. Said apparatus comprises 1 a circular hood fitted to the section where a loaded raw film starts stretching and a formed stretching bubble expands to its maximum diameter, 2 holders for a plurality of rolls, which holders are mounted on the lower part of said hood, said rolls being held each on the end of said holders which an elasticity allowing swinging of said rolls only in the direction radial to the central axis of said bubble but resistant to being distorted in the direction of circumference of said stretching bubble, and 3 a flexible and shrinkable cylindrical sheet attached to and along the inside lower surface of said hood, the lower end of said sheet being situated immediately above the roll part of said holders.
